Abstract:

The twenty-first century is the data revolution century and especially in the last decade, the dataanalysis methods are used by most scholars and practitioners in all scientific fields. Projectmanagement is a social science with heavy reliance on data, and the available data in projects can beconstructed, semi-constructed or unconstructed information and project managers rely on this data tomake the decision. Because project managers overwhelmed with data and information most of thetime they make the decision when the problem occurred and it makes project inefficient andineffective business. The data analyzing tools for project managers seem crucial, and big data analysisis useful tools to analyze the huge volume of any type of data and big data analysis techniques arestrong tools. Here in this study the history of big data analysis in project management is reviewed andbased on finding the new agenda in the application on big data analysis in project managementproposed. The study's methodology is based on combination of a systematic literature review andbibliometric analysis. By reviewing the history of the application of big data in project managementthe gaps are identified and the new agenda for future development agendas are introduced. This articleis a database for practitioners to find the application of the project management big data applicationsand is a guideline for project management and big data analysis for future study. Big data analysiswill play a significant role in social science, especially the multidisciplinary field of science likeproject management.
